More than 20 transgender people attempt suicide together by ingesting floor cleaner in India

India.- Around 24 transgender people attempted suicide by ingesting floor cleaner last Wednesday in the Indian city of Indore. The incident occurred after a heated dispute amid growing tensions between two factions of the local transgender community, reported the Hindustan Times newspaper.

The authorities received information about an altercation in a house in the area known as Nandlalpura and upon arriving they were informed that several people had taken an unknown substance. They immediately called the national emergency system and were transferred and admitted to a nearby hospital, where everyone remains stable.

Although it is not clear what the motive for the collective suicide attempt was, it would have been a desperate act in response to the inaction of the authorities in the face of alleged aggressions and intimidations against the community. It is alleged that the leader of one group was harassing members of another, incited by mutual rivalry.

The Times of India señala that a trans woman appeared at a police station and stated that she and her followers were being threatened and psychologically harassed by several individuals for several months, which would have caused the recent events.

Some are concretely relating the fact to the alleged violation of a trans person at the hands of two individuals who claimed to be journalists. Although the abuse would have occurred three months ago, the victim filed a complaint again this Tuesday. And on Wednesday, while the 24 intoxicated people were being urgently transferred, other members of the transgender community arrived at the hospital demanding measures against the alleged aggressors. They also tried to commit suicide by dousing themselves with kerosene, but agents prevented it. The Police reported the arrest of the alleged rapists. At the same time, an investigation is underway within the trans community, divided by leadership issues with ongoing clashes in recent months over territorial and financial dominance. An officer stated that there is a long-standing dispute with accusations of harassment and extortion that have led to multiple and frequent complaints at various police stations in Indore.
